A TELUS AI agent approached sustainability like a chess game
Everything in this small, nondescript datacentre comes in singles. There's one server, one cooling unit, and one cardinal rule: stay within thermal guidelines. It's into this setting that TELUS released an AI agent tasked with cooling the room as efficiently as possible, and gave it virtual carte blanche to figure out how. This was the first real-world test in TELUS' Energy Optimization System Project (EOS), a pilot in which a reinforcement learning agent took control of a real physical system in order to teach itself how to best operate it. Two months prior, that same agent had showed it could increase energy efficiency by 2%-15% in a simulator, thanks in large part to a series of its own ingenious innovations.

How Canadian businesses are using AI – Elevate day two
Elevate Tech Fest day two was a whirlwind event, with more than a dozen different'tracks' spread out across Toronto that focused on everything from fintech to health, smart cities and more. IT World Canada spent the day attending the artificial intelligence (AI) track and learned about some interesting ways that Canadian companies are using AI. As a leader in the world of AI development and research Canada is home to a number of AI research labs for many of the big names in tech including Facebook, Microsoft, Alphabet Inc., LG Electronics, Adobe Systems Inc., which have opened labs in Toronto, Montreal and Edmonton or Vancouver. And not to forget MaRS Discovery Centre which hosted today's AI event, and has housed and helped AI companies like Element AI and Rubikloud. Layer 6 AI co-founder and chief AI office for TD Bank Jordan Jacobs helped start-off the discussion around just how big a role Canada plays in the AI industry, calling it the country that essentially created AI technology.
